About Quail Ridge RV Park
What makes Quail Ridge RV Park in Mayer, Arizona, stand out is its balance of well-maintained facilities, recreational opportunities, and a serene atmosphere in a scenic high-desert environment. Visitors can enjoy spacious pull-through RV sites with full hookups, fiber optic Wi-Fi, and modern conveniences like private showers, restrooms, and laundry facilities. Adding to the appeal is a free 9-hole miniature golf course, two dog parks, a playground, and a horseshoe pit, offering entertainment options for all ages.
Located just a few minutes from excellent hiking and ATV/UTV trails, Quail Ridge RV Park is the perfect gateway for outdoor enthusiasts. Its proximity to attractions like Arcosanti and the High Desert Heritage Museum ensures easy access to cultural and natural landmarks. The park's central location also makes it a great stopover for travelers heading to Prescott or Sedona, both about 45 minutes away.
